BACKGROUND INFORMATION:

The Community Development Advisory Committee so appointed by the city council shall serve in an advisory capacity to the city council on matters relating to the community development block grant program funds, making recommendations for the expenditure of those funds for eligible projects designed to assist low- and moderate-income citizens and eliminate slum and blight within the city, and projects that will benefit the citizens of the city.

 

The committee shall be composed of nine citizens of the city, as broadly representative of all aspects of the community as possible and including at least two low-to-moderate income residents. Members serve three-year terms. 

 

The City Secretary’s Office received applications through September 30, 2025.  The Ad Hoc Committee is recommending the appointments of Scott Morehouse, Serena Morris, and Dylan Ott, for the three (3) positions on the Community Development Advisory Committee with three terms ending 11-30-28 for council consideration.
